/ Dictionary / Index M molybdenite: Meaning and Definition of Find definitions for: mo•lyb•de•nite Pronunciation: (mu-lib'du-nīt"), [key] — n. a soft, graphitelike mineral, molybdenum sulfide, MoS, occurring in foliated masses or scales: the principal ore of molybdenum.
